What features to look for in the best antivirus software

Computer or system, being a program dependent machine, becomes idle if any harm or attack is done on the programming platform or system application. Antivirus software is a specially designed program which helps preventing the entry of susceptible or harmful programs or files into the computer system.

Good antivirus software should be robust enough to update itself of the latest threats and exposure to maliciously designed programs. Static antivirus software has obsolete data base of malwares and viruses and fails in providing complete security over internet. Though it can be substantial while working offline, an online web presence cannot stand to these types of outdated antivirus software. Antivirus software is not meant to provide simple scanning and virus detection feature alone but also in working as a shield against susceptible entries which are supposed to harm the system configuration. Some even create a virtual copy of system to alter the direction of virus attack.

While programming antivirus software, it is accompanied with numerous technicalities to detect and prohibit harmful entries as every virus or worm is unique in its composition. Antivirus software equipped with just one type of armour is not a good solution against protecting your valuable data and information. Moreover, good antivirus software should not make the system processing slow and hanging frequently because it is built upon much technical superiority. Antivirus software should be user friendly and consist of a simple and understandable help and guide feature so that even the neophytes can handle it with ease.

Antivirus software detects harms through false positives and false negatives. A good one should be efficient in responsiveness towards false positives as these are more dangerous than false negatives. Complex notices and prompts can pose confusing situations in front of inexperienced users and ultimately greater chances arise for security breach and potential risks and attacks. The methods of detection used by the antivirus software should be according to the latest developments and also clear to the user. Sometimes, the user cannot decide between quarantine and other actions which the antivirus software prompts. This makes the whole purpose of antivirus software fruitless.

The best antivirus software should be able to provide performance, real time detection and security and low cost up-gradation with privacy features in hand. It should not conflict with the already installed or existing defender or firewall application of windows, nor inhibit the security of other threat detection tools. Good antivirus software is supposed to make the virus or worm detected idle and not allowing it to replicate over the system or corrupt the files on the computer. The licensed user agreement of the antivirus software should also be renewed from time to time to facilitate authentic and genuine protection.
